#8dca86 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8dca86 is composed of 55.3% red, 79.2%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 113.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 65.9%. #8dca86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1b950d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8dca86

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4faf3 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#8dca86 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b0b0b0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a9b5a8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cdbe86 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#deb793 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a1c3d2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b5c286 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c0be8e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9ac6b6 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
